Responsibilities
Client Engagement : Actively connect with potential clients to understand their insurance needs and offer customized solutions.
Insurance Guidance : Provide expert advice on various insurance products, including auto, home, and life, to ensure optimal coverage for clients.
Policy Management : Assist clients in understanding their policies and making necessary adjustments to optimize their benefits.
Sales Target Achievement : Strive to meet and exceed sales targets through effective strategies and persistent follow-up.
Lead Generation : Identify and develop new business opportunities through networking and strategic relationships.
Client Relationship Building : Nurture long-lasting relationships with clients through consistent, personalized service and engagement.
Requirement
Licensing : Must possess an active Wisconsin Property & Casualty License.
Experience : Proven track record in insurance sales is highly desirable.
Communication Skills : Excellent verbal and written communication skills are crucial.
Customer Service : Strong commitment to providing exceptional customer service and ability to build lasting client relationships.
Problem-Solving : Capable of effectively identifying client needs and offering solutions tailored to those needs.
Sales Skills : Strong understanding of sales techniques and ability to cross-sell insurance products.
Team Orientation : Ability to work collaboratively within a team-focused environment.
Motivation : Highly driven to meet and exceed sales targets.
Salary : $40,000 - $55,000
